Goals

Organizations and business are overwhelmed by the flood of data continuously collected into their data warehouses and arriving from external sources – the Web above all. Traditional exploratory techniques may fail to make sense of the data, due to its inherent complexity and size. Data mining and knowledge discovery techniques emerged as an alternative approach, aimed at revealing patterns, rules and models hidden in the data, and at supporting the analytical user to develop descriptive and predictive models for a number of business problems, notably in the CRM domain.

Syllabus

  • Basic concepts of data mining and the knowledge discovery process.
  • Data and data sources.
  • Exploratory data analysis.
  • Fundamental data mining tasks and methods: clustering, classification and prediction, patterns and association rules.
  • Hints on descriptive and predictive analytics for CRM tasks: customer segmentation, churn analysis, promo redemption, product recommendation, market basket analysis.
  • Discussion of industrial data mining projects for CRM in retail, both traditional and online.

Exercise

  • Breast Cancer Wisconsin (Diagnostic) Data Set. Assigned on: 07.03.2013. To be completed within: 18.03.2013. Send papers (3 pages max of text, figures excluded) by email to pedre [at] di [dot] unipi [dot] it cc: Fosca Giannottifosca [dot] giannotti [at] gmail [dot] com. Use “[DM-MAINS] ” in the subject. Download the wpbc.data dataset from the UCI archive. The dataset contains observations on samples of breast tissue, together with their classification as benign or malignant, as performed by istologists. You are supposed to perform the following tasks: 1) Data understanding and exploratory analysis; 2) clustering analysis (disregarding the class information), including description of the discovered (best) clusters; 3) classification analysis using decision trees for the task of diagnosing a sample as benign or malignant. Describe the process adopted to select the proposed clustering/tree, together with their quality evaluation.
